Oracle
 sql >> Teknologi Basis Data >  >> RDS >> Oracle

Oracle regex menggantikan beberapa kemunculan string yang dikelilingi oleh koma

karena regex Oracle memindahkan posisi yang cocok ke depan setelah pertandingan, sayangnya Anda perlu melakukan regexp dua kali lipat

regexp_replace(regexp_replace(col1,'(^|,)(SL)(\W|$)','\1\3',1,0,'imn') ,'(^|,)(SL)(\W|$)','\1\3',1,0,'imn')


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Apakah ada cara untuk membuat beberapa pemicu dalam satu skrip?

  2. meneruskan array ke prosedur tersimpan

  3. Menggunakan urutan Oracle untuk memasukkan id log ke dalam 2 tabel dari jdbc?

  4. Oracle:Saya memerlukan gabungan luar sebagian. Lihat gambarnya

  5. Halaman beranda Oracle 10g express tidak muncul